Abstract
A method by a network device for assigning data types to data values included in application programming interface (API) responses sent by an API server to one or more API clients via an API. The method includes obtaining a first set of API responses from an endpoint of the API, generating a profile for the endpoint of the API based on analyzing the first set of API responses, where the profile of the endpoint indicates an expected structure of API responses and expected data types associated with data fields included in API responses, obtaining a second set of API responses, and using the profile of the endpoint of the API to assign data types to data values included in API responses in the second set of API responses.
